Size
It is possible to think that bunk beds are only for children however, they can be a great solution for older children and adults who want to maximize the sleeping space in their homes. There are many adult bunk bed designs that are available in a variety of sizes from twin over full to queen or king. They can also be fitted with a built-in desk or other features to create a study room or dressing area in a tiny space.
The first consideration to make when looking for a bunk bed is to determine how much height you're willing to put in your child's room. The majority of standard bunk beds are twin over twin and can accommodate a twin-sized mattress measuring 75 inches by 38 inches. However, there are "shorty" bunk beds that come with a shorter twin size mattress that is just a little over 3 feet long.
Another factor to consider when purchasing a bunk bed is the method your child will use to access the top and bottom bunks. Some bunk beds double bed beds have angled ladders while others have stairs. The ones with stairs are most popular by younger children, as they can safely climb up and down in a seated position. If you decide to buy a bunk bed that has a ladder, you will have to consider the space you would like to leave in your child's room so that they can be able to move around and sleep comfortably.

Safety
Bunk beds can be a lot of fun However, safety is of paramount importance especially for children. Most injuries to children in bunk beds occur while sleeping or playing. They can result in bruises, cuts and concussions. Strangulation is one of the most serious injuries. Parents should take into account the age and size their children when choosing bunk beds. They should also adhere to the manufacturer's guidelines, inspect the bunk bed regularly and make sure that all accessories are compatible.
The most important thing to remember is that children younger than six years old should not be sleeping on the top bunk. The majority of injuries that occur in bunk beds happen when children fall off the upper bunk while playing or sleeping. In addition the top of the bed should not be too close to the ceiling since it could result in head injuries.
Guardrails must be installed on the entire upper bunk bed. The guardrail should not be more than 3" from the mattress. Ladder openings should also be 16cm in width and should not be at the bottom of the bed frame.
Parents should not only ensure that bunk beds are secured but also show their children the importance of safety within the vicinity of the bed. This includes not stepping onto the upper bunk without an adult present and teaching their children to use the ladder correctly. It is also important to emphasize that the upper bunk is not a place to jump and rough play.
In addition, it is essential to keep the bunk bed free from electrical appliances, such as lamps or ceiling fans, which can cause fires. Bunk beds should also be kept away from objects that ignite, like curtains or carpets. A night light could be set near the ladder to help children find it in the darkness. Parents should also not hang items from the railings of the guards on the top bunk, including jump ropes or scarves, as these can become strangulation hazards.
